KATHMANDU, Nov 24: Six years since its establishment, the Social Security Fund (SSF) has collected a total of 95.44 billion from its contributors.
According to the SSF, the amount was collected from its 2.64 million plus contributors of 22,309 listed enterprises.

Likewise, the SSF has settled the claims of Rs 17.64 billion so far. As shared by the SSF, Rs 2.51 billion was paid for medical expenses, Rs 228.6 million for accidents and disabilities, and Rs 290.7 million from the dependent family security scheme.
It shared that more than Rs 14.6 billion was paid for the retirement claim scheme.
The effectiveness of the Fund has improved as the foreign migrant workers should mandatorily participate in the contribution-based social security system.
